|  | Three Little Pigs by Joanna C. Galdone, Paul Galdone A picture-book retelling of the story of three pigs who each build a different type of house to keep a hungry wolf at bay. Here the first two pigs are eaten by the wolf, while the third brother manages to outwit the wolf a number of times before eating him for dinner. Colorful ink illustrations accompany the text.  | Readings in the History of Christian Theology by William C. Placher William C. Placher compiles significant passages written by the most important Christian thinkers through the early sixteenth century. An important resource for theological study, the book contains excerpts preceded by the author's illuminating introductions so that the book can stand alone as a coherent history. It can also be used to supplement a narrative work such as William Placher's own A History of Christian Theology: an Introduction. Rather than institutional history, the book focuses on ideas presented from an ecumenical perspective. AUTHOR: William C.  | 1st to Die by Dylan Baker, James Patterson, Melissa Leo Introducing the Women's Murder Club--a quartet of San Francisco women who have teamed up to apprehend the city's most terrifying serial killer. They are, in no particular order: a journalist; a medical examiner; an assistant DA; and SFPD detective Lindsay Boxer, this new series's tormented heroine. In FIRST TO DIE, the club is on the trail of a murderer who kills couples on their wedding nights and sexually molests the brides' corpses.  | Dolphin Treasure by Jim Fowler, Wayne Grover This sequel to Dolphin Adventure continues the story of Wayne Grover and Baby, a young dolphin. In this story, Wayne is separated from his partners during a diving adventure off the Florida coast. Alone and lost in a stormy sea, Baby is Wayne's only hope for survival.
